Deep Acting
An emotional labor strategy where individuals attempt to feel the emotions they are supposed to display, rather than just superficially acting them out.
Internal Emotion
A personal and subjective experience of feeling, which originates inside an individual and can influence their thoughts and behavior.
Fear
A primal emotion experienced in anticipation of some specific pain or danger, often leading to behavioral changes such as fight or flight.
Embarrassment
A feeling of self-consciousness, shame, or awkwardness that arises from a socially uncomfortable situation.
